I drilled and pulled out the restrictor end caps off a set of Stock Speed Triple pipes that's now on my Sprint. On de-accel., I notice it has a popping, could mean a little fuel screw tweak, or something that occurs when the 'system' is simply upset. The increase in 'Tone' is minimal really, at idle there is a bit more rumble and on blipping too. As to when you ride I would say a slight performance drop, ever so slight - the roll on is a little less, wooly perhaps. It's all very metaphysical I know but there is always a doubt and chances are it's not a reversible route taking the end caps off. It might be simpler to pick up a couple of matched cans from a Scrap yard and make them fit. Just my 10 cents worth.

I bought a pair of used Micron slip on's. They were so loud they made my ears itch. So I made a pair of restrictor plates that went between the can and the end cap with holes as large as the original exits. That helped but the tone was high and poppy. I did get a pretty good boost of performance though.

Late this fall I saw a new pair of overstocked Staintune's at about half price. I decided to get them because I am keeping the bike indefinatley. They are beautiful, and fit perfectly without the use of a mid pipe. Very nicely engineered pipes. I was able to put them on before the snow and run em a couple of days. They sound very nice. deep note, same performance as the Microns. less noticeable backfire.

Never tried the thing with removing the original pipe baffels.
